<?php
return [
/*
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
| Driver
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
| The default driver you would like to use for location retrieval.
|
*/
'driver' => Stevebauman\Location\Drivers\IpApi::class,
/*
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
| Driver Fallbacks
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
| The drivers you want to use to retrieve the user's location
| if the above selected driver is unavailable.
|
| These will be called upon in order (first to last).
|
*/
'fallbacks' => [
Stevebauman\Location\Drivers\IpInfo::class,
Stevebauman\Location\Drivers\GeoPlugin::class,
Stevebauman\Location\Drivers\MaxMind::class,
],
/*
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
| Position
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
| Here you may configure the position instance that is created
| and returned from the above drivers. The instance you
| create must extend the built-in Position class.
|
*/
'position' => Stevebauman\Location\Position::class,
/*
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
| Localhost Testing
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
| If your running your website locally and want to test different
| IP addresses to see location detection, set 'enabled' to true.
|
| The testing IP address is a Google host in the United-States.
|
*/
'testing' => [
'ip' => '66.102.0.0',
'enabled' => env('LOCATION_TESTING', false),
],
/*
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
| MaxMind Configuration
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
| If web service is enabled, you must fill in your user ID and license key.
|
| If web service is disabled, it will try and retrieve the user's location
| from the MaxMind database file located in the local path below.
|
| The MaxMind database file can be either City (default) or Country (smaller).
|
*/
'maxmind' => [
'web' => [
'enabled' => false,
'user_id' => env('MAXMIND_USER_ID'),
'license_key' => env('MAXMIND_LICENSE_KEY'),
'options' => ['host' => 'geoip.maxmind.com'],
],
'local' => [
'type' => 'city',
'path' => database_path('maxmind/GeoLite2-City.mmdb'),
'url' => sprintf('https://download.maxmind.com/app/geoip_download?edition_id=GeoLite2-City&license_key=%s&suffix=tar.gz', env('MAXMIND_LICENSE_KEY')),
],
],
'ip_api' => [
'token' => env('IP_API_TOKEN'),
],
'ipinfo' => [
'token' => env('IPINFO_TOKEN'),
],
'ipdata' => [
'token' => env('IPDATA_TOKEN'),
],
/*
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
| Kloudend ~ ipapi.co Configuration
|--------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
| The configuration for the Kloudend driver.
|
*/
'kloudend' => [
'token' => env('KLOUDEND_TOKEN'),
],
];
